什么是蜘蛛爬行?
蜘蛛爬行是一种网页爬取技术,搜索引擎利用这种技术来抓取网页的内容和索引。之所以称之为蜘蛛爬行,是因为这种技术的工作方式很像蜘蛛在网上爬行搜索食物一样。
蜘蛛爬行如何工作?
在开始蜘蛛爬行之前,搜索引擎会先确定要抓取哪些网页。这通常是通过搜索引擎自己设定的规则来决定的,例如页面的关键词、网址的结构等。接下来,搜索引擎会像蜘蛛一样从一个页面爬行到另一个页面,抓取所有可用的链接和页面内容。在抓取页面的同时,搜索引擎会将页面内容和链接存储到它的索引库中,以备将来的搜索和排名使用。
蜘蛛爬行的重要性
蜘蛛爬行是搜索引擎优化(SEO)最重要的组成部分之一。有了好的爬行技术,搜索引擎就能够更快、更全面地了解网站内容,从而更加准确地确定网站的排名和搜索结果。因此,对于那些想要在搜索引擎上获得良好排名的网站来说,优化其蜘蛛爬行技术是至关重要的。
蜘蛛爬行有哪些限制?
虽然蜘蛛爬行是一种非常强大且重要的技术,但是,网站所有者可以对其进行限制,以保护其网站数据和内容。例如,网站所有者可以通过robots.txt文件来告诉搜索引擎蜘蛛不应该抓取哪些页面或目录。此外,网站所有者还可以设置访问速率限制,在一定时间内只允许蜘蛛爬行访问一定数量的页面,从而避免对服务器的过度负载。
如何优化网站的蜘蛛爬行?
为了确保搜索引擎能够更好地了解您的网站内容,优化蜘蛛爬行技术是至关重要的。以下是几种优化技巧:
合理的网站结构
一个逻辑、易于理解的网站结构能够帮助蜘蛛更快、更全面地抓取页面。确保每个页面都有一个清晰的标题和描述,并尽可能将类似的内容归类在一起,可以更好地帮助搜索引擎了解您的网站结构。
高质量的链接
一个拥有高质量链接的网站会更受搜索引擎的喜欢,这也意味着蜘蛛爬行过程中更容易发现高质量内容。因此,在增加链接时,应该将重点放在质量而不是数量上,确保这些链接指向有关主题的高质量内容。
创建XML网站地图
创建XML网站地图是另一种优化蜘蛛爬行的技术,它能够告诉搜索引擎整个网站的结构以及哪些页面是最重要的。将XML地图提交到搜索引擎可以帮助蜘蛛更快地了解您的网站,并提高内容被发现和索引的机会。
使用优化好的robots.txt文件
一个合理的robots.txt文件能够告诉蜘蛛哪些页面可以抓取,哪些页面不可以抓取。这有助于减轻服务器负载、保护敏感数据和页面内容,并使蜘蛛抓取更加高效。
蜘蛛爬行是搜索引擎优化的重要一环。通过使用正确的技术,您可以优化网站的蜘蛛爬行,从而提高搜索引擎结果排名、实现更好的搜索引擎优化效果。
还没有评论,来说两句吧...